Synopsis

Longlisted for the Center for Fiction First Novel Prize

‘Chung’s writing is masterful, and Sea Change is glorious’ – Bryan Washington, author Memorial

Aquarium worker Ro’s life is imploding:

1. Her boyfriend is on a one-way mission to Mars
2. Her best friend is ignoring her existence
3. Dolores (the giant Pacific octopus) is going to be sold

As storms rage around her, can Ro get back on course?
